Output 83dc8c6b28156948d278b9dbe360a5652489b001371dc09296fe3d6ee463b64b:38

value
105149659
script pubkey
OP_0 OP_PUSHBYTES_20 f2f577d6f209d3003c6ffde5dce4542990fca292
address
ltc1q7t6h04hjp8fsq0r0lhjaeez59xg0eg5ju7lteg
transaction
83dc8c6b28156948d278b9dbe360a5652489b001371dc09296fe3d6ee463b64b
spent
true